Can I exercise during my menstrual period?

Women who pay more attention to health will exercise at a fixed time every day. If a woman is used to exercising, doing some small, low-intensity exercises during menstruation will not have any side effects. It can also enhance immunity and improve mood. But it should be noted that you cannot do a lot of strenuous exercise, such as long-distance running, jumping, sit-ups, etc., which should be prohibited. You should also avoid extensive exercise a few days before menstruation, otherwise it is easy to cause dysmenorrhea and increased menstrual blood volume. Appropriate exercise during menstruation can help the body expel menstrual blood faster and relieve premenstrual syndrome.

During menstruation, many women experience physical discomfort. Therefore, three days before your period, you can decide the form of exercise according to your own situation, focusing on gentle, soothing, relaxing and stretching exercises, such as meditative yoga, elementary body gymnastics, or just doing some simple stretching exercises at home. These light exercises help the blood flow smoothly in the body and relieve stress. During exercise, be sure to avoid putting pressure on the abdominal cavity and avoid raising the legs too high. If you feel tired or notice a sudden increase or decrease in bleeding, stop exercising immediately.

On the fifth day of the menstrual period, the body begins to recover and you can start doing aerobic exercises such as slow walking and jogging. However, you should still avoid some ball games and heavy weight sports.
